
Project Execution - Technical Project Manager
At J.P. Morgan Chase & Co., we are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Project Execution - Technical Project Manager to join our dynamic team. As a leader in the financial services industry, we are constantly striving to deliver innovative solutions to our clients. In this role, you will be responsible for the successful execution and delivery of complex technical projects, utilizing your strong project management skills and technical expertise. We are looking for a driven individual who is passionate about driving results and achieving business objectives. If you possess a strong technical background, exceptional project management skills, and a desire to make an impact in a fast-paced environment, we encourage you to apply.
- Successfully plan, execute, and deliver complex technical projects within the financial services industry, meeting all project deliverables and timelines.
- Utilize strong project management skills to develop and maintain project plans, budgets, and resources.
- Act as the primary point of contact for all project-related communications, providing regular updates and progress reports to stakeholders.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ify project requirements and dependencies, and ensure alignment with business objectives and strategies.
- Proactively identify and mitigate project risks, and provide solutions to overcome any obstacles.
- Manage project scope, change requests, and budget, ensuring all changes are properly documented and approved.
- Lead and motivate project team members to ensure high-quality project delivery.
- Utilize technical expertise to provide guidance and support to project team members, as well as review and validate technical deliverables.
- Foster strong working relationships with clients and stakeholders, ensuring their needs and expectations are met.
- Continuously monitor project progress and performance, and make adjustments as needed to ensure project success.
- Keep up-to-date with industry trends and best practices to drive innovation and efficiency within project execution.
- Adhere to company policies, procedures, and guidelines to ensure compliance and maintain high standards of quality.
- Act as a mentor and coach to junior project managers, providing guidance and support as needed.
Bachelor's Degree In Computer Science, Engineering, Or A Related Field
At Least 5 Years Of Experience In Project Management, Specifically In The Technology Industry
Proven Track Record Of Successfully Managing Complex Technical Projects, Including Budgeting And Resource Allocation
Strong Understanding Of Project Management Methodologies, Such As Agile Or Waterfall, And Experience Implementing Them In Previous Projects
Excellent Communication And Leadership Skills, With The Ability To Effectively Collaborate With Cross-Functional Teams And Stakeholders.

JPMorgan Chase & Co. is an American multinational investment bank and financial services holding company headquartered in New York City. JPMorgan Chase is ranked by S&P Global as the largest bank in the United States and the sixth largest bank in the world by total assets, with total assets of US$2.687 trillion.
